So the nervous servant who tells Macbeth his castle is under attack is dismissed as a cream-faced loon. Oswald in King Lear isnt just a useless idiot, hes a whoreson zed, an unnecessary letter. Lears ungrateful daughter Goneril is a plague-sore, an embossed carbuncle in my corrupted blood. And when Falstaff doubts something Mistress Quickly has said in Henry IV: Part 1, he claims, theres no more faith in thee than in a stewed prune. (And theres a good chance he didnt intend stewed prune to mean dried fruit.) In Anglo-Saxon England the pupil of the eye was known as the apple (Old English ppel) since it was thought to be an apple-shaped solid. To make sure that they did not sell underweight bread, bakers started to give an extra piece of bread away with every loaf, and a thirteenth loaf with every dozen. By the fourteenth-century the phrase nest egg was used by peasants to explain why they left one egg in the nest when collecting them from hens it would encourage the chickens to continue laying eggs in the same nest. In Greek mythology, one of The Twelve Labors of Hercules was to destroy the Stymphalian birds, a flock of monstrous, man-eating birds with metal beaks and feathers, who produced a stinking and highly toxic guano. The post, which was officially known as Promoter of the Faith (promotor fidei), seems to have been established by Pope Leo X in the early sixteenth-century. Some examples of the words he invented are: accused, addiction, advertising, assasination, bedroom, bloodstained, fashionable, gossip, hint, impede, invulnerable, mimic, monumental, negotiate, rant, secure, submerge, and swagger.
